Define the question before measuring
New windows, insulation, finishes or ventilation can alter pressure, temperature and drying even when the new work is not visibly defective.
Capture a useful baseline
Record the exact location, date, current weather or equipment state, recent activities and the first visible, audible, sensory or measurable change. Keep one unaffected reference point.
Safe observations to repeat
- Create a before-and-after timeline
- List changed materials and systems
- Compare affected and untouched areas
Compare supporting and weakening evidence
Supports the pathway
- Symptoms begin after the renovation
- Old and new assemblies meet nearby
- Ventilation or heating behavior changed
Weakens the pathway
- The symptom predates the work
- A direct unrelated leak is confirmed
- No relevant layer changed
Interpret the result conservatively
Look for a repeatable relationship between trigger, location, timing and change. Treat exceptions as useful evidence rather than forcing every event into one explanation.
Escalation boundary
Do not reverse or perforate controlled layers without understanding the whole assembly.
Close the loop
If work is performed, repeat the same observation under a comparable trigger and through the original lag window. Record both recurrence and non-recurrence events.
